- 0.137u3: Improvements to Shark Party (English, Alpha license) [Roberto Fresca]: Created complete inputs from the scratch. Added coin/keyin/keyout counters. Added main game and double-up rates dipswitches. Added minimum bet dipswitches. Added maximum bet dipswitches. Added complete coinage and remote credits dipswitches. Added jokers and demo sounds dipswitches. Figured out and documented all the game outputs. Created proper button-lamps layout. Now the game is in full-working state.
- 0.137u2: Kevin Eshbach, Smitdogg and The Dumping Union added clone Shark Party (English, Alpha license).
- 27th March 2010: Smitdogg - We got Victor 6 by Subsino. It looks like it runs on the same hardware as Shark Party. Edit: This actually turned out to be an alt. version of Shark Party. Apparently Subsino reused some of their PCBs for newer released games. This happened once before when a supposed Victor 5 PCB was purchased.
- 0.136u2: Improvements to Shark Party [Roberto Fresca]: Added stats and settings inputs. Added coin counters. Added button-lamps layout. Added dipswitches 'Coinage', 'Demo Sounds', 'Double-Up', 'Main Game Rate' and 'Double-Up Rate'. Changed Z180 CPU1 clock speed to 1.5MHz.
- 0.135u4: Angelo Salese and David Haywood fixed Shark Party - Game now playable. Swapped tilemap roms ($0, 20000). Changed description to 'Shark Party (Italy, v1.3)'.
- 0.127: Added Player 1, 5x buttons and coin slot. Added 32x 'Unknown' dipswitch.
- 0.125u5: Luca Elia added 'Shark Party' (Subsino 1993) and clone (alt).
- 25th March 2008: f205v dumped Shark Party and (alt).
